looking to install  an electric pump (non automatic)   for water tank when we lose water supply    any recommendations?  thanks

A good brand is Hicharchi or Mitsubishi.

If you go onto the Electrical Forum, one of the pinned topics (I think) should be a diagram of how to connect your water system.

Most of us use automatic constant pressure pumps.

Threads about water pumps are found here or in DIY forum.

 

We have a Mitsubishi WP 255 with pressure tank attached.

Pressure tank much recommend to avoid frequent on/off.

 

255 is the power in Watt.

We have a two storey house.

If you have a ground floor only, a smaller model might suffice.

As above: Hitachi and Mitsubishi are most popular here. Can't do much wrong.
